You have provisioned a custom VPC with a subnet that has a CIDR block of 10.0.3.0/28 address range. Inside this subnet, you have 2 webservers, 2 application servers, 2 database servers, and a NAT. You have configured an Autoscaling group on the two web servers to automatically scale when the CPU utilization goes above 90%. Several days later you notice that autoscaling is no longer deploying new instances into the subnet, despite the CPU utilization of all web servers being at 100%. Which of the following answers may offer an explanation?
a. AWS reserves both the first four and the last IP address in each subnet's CIDR block.
b. Your Autoscaling Group (ASG) has provisioned too many EC2 instances and has exhausted the number of internal IP addresses available in the subnet.
c. Your internet gateway (IGW) on your VPC has provisioned too many EC2 instances.
d. AWS reserves both the first two and the last two IP addresses in each subnet's CIDR block.
e. AWS reserves both the first three and the last two IP addresses in each subnet's CIDR block.
